The default value seems to be smoothing_level=None, but I am not sure why the fit function is not working out of the box. WebHere we run three variants of simple exponential smoothing: 1. In fit1 we do not use the auto optimization but instead choose to explicitly provide the model with the α = 0.2 parameter 2. In fit2 as above we choose an α = 0.6 3. In fit3 we allow statsmodels to automatically find an optimized α value for us.

WebDec 14, 2024 · Data smoothing refers to a statistical approach of eliminating outliers from datasets to make the patterns more noticeable. It is achieved using algorithms to eliminate statistical noise from datasets. The use of data smoothing can help forecast patterns, such as those seen in share prices. WebSpecify smoothing factor alpha directly. 0 &lt; alpha &lt;= 1. min_periods: int, default None. Minimum number of observations in window required to have a value (otherwise result is NA). ignore_na: bool, default False. Ignore missing values when calculating weights. When ignore_na=False (default), weights are based on absolute positions.
